Understanding Video Quality Issues on Android

Common Video Quality Problems

Ever watched a video and thought, "Why does this look so bad?" Common issues include blurriness, where the image isn't sharp, making it hard to see details. Then there's noise, which looks like random specks or graininess, especially in darker scenes. Low resolution is another problem, where the video looks pixelated because it doesn't have enough pixels to show a clear picture. These problems can make watching videos frustrating.

Causes of Poor Video Quality

Several factors can mess up video quality. Using a low-quality recording device is a big one. If your phone or camera isn't great, the videos won't be either. Poor lighting can also ruin a video. If it's too dark or the light is uneven, the video will look bad. Compression artifacts happen when videos are compressed to save space. This can create weird blocky patterns and reduce overall quality. All these factors can turn a potentially great video into something hard to watch.

Steps to Improve Video Quality on Your Device

  1. Open your camera app.
  2. Tap on the settings icon, usually a gear symbol.
  3. Scroll down to find the "Video Quality" option.
  4. Select the highest resolution available, like 1080p or 4K.
  5. Enable stabilization if your phone supports it.
  6. Adjust the frame rate to 60fps for smoother videos.
  7. Turn on HDR if available for better colors.
  8. Close settings and start recording.

Tips for Optimal Video Quality

  1. Adjust Resolution: Go to your camera settings and increase the resolution for sharper videos. Higher resolution means more detail.

  2. Lighting: Always record in good lighting. Natural light works best. If indoors, use bright lamps or LED lights.

  3. Stabilize Your Device: Use a tripod or stabilizer to avoid shaky footage. If you don’t have one, keep your hands steady or lean against a solid surface.

  4. Focus: Tap on your subject on the screen to lock focus. This ensures your main subject stays sharp.

  5. Frame Rate: Set your camera to record at 60fps for smoother motion, especially for action shots.

  6. Audio Quality: Use an external microphone for clearer sound. Built-in mics often pick up background noise.

  7. Editing Apps: Use apps like Adobe Premiere Rush or KineMaster to enhance video quality post-recording. Adjust brightness, contrast, and add filters.

  8. Clean Lens: Always wipe your camera lens before recording. Dust or smudges can blur your video.

  9. Use Manual Mode: If your phone supports it, switch to manual mode. Adjust ISO, shutter speed, and white balance for better control.

  10. Avoid Digital Zoom: Instead of zooming in digitally, move closer to your subject. Digital zoom reduces quality.

  11. Use Grid Lines: Turn on grid lines in your camera settings to help frame your shots better. This helps keep horizons straight and subjects centered.

  12. Background: Choose a clean, uncluttered background. It makes your subject stand out more.

  13. Practice: Experiment with different settings and practice recording in various environments to understand what works best.

Troubleshooting Video Quality Problems

Blurry videos often result from low resolution. Adjust the camera settings to the highest resolution available. If videos appear shaky, use a tripod or stabilize your hands while recording. Dim lighting can cause grainy footage; record in well-lit areas or use external lights. Slow playback might be due to low storage; clear unnecessary files to free up space. If videos won't play, update your media player app or try a different one. For audio issues, ensure the microphone is unobstructed and clean. If the problem persists, restart the device or perform a factory reset as a last resort.
